Dr Alastair Smith, Chief Executive of Avacta Group plc commented:
"I believe that we are on the verge of a paradigm shift in how chemotherapy is delivered to cancer patients.
The safety and initial efficacy signals emerging from the data in the AVA6000 Phase 1 study are very encouraging indeed. The pre|CISIONTM platform is doing exactly what it was designed to do - target the release of active chemotherapy to the tumour tissue, sparing healthy tissues and improving the safety and tolerability of the drug whilst delivering potentially superior efficacy.
I'm particularly pleased that, even at this early stage and in this patient group, we have a confirmed, significant response in a patient with soft tissue sarcoma, as well as other positive signals across a number of other patients.
We're now aiming to accelerate the clinical development of AVA6000 and begin the Phase 2 efficacy study earlier than originally planned. The Phase 2 trial will follow a short study to determine the safety and efficacy of fortnightly dosing to allow us to determine the recommended Phase 2 dosing regimen.
I look forward very much to sharing the detailed data from the Phase 1a study in due course."
